What online medication management actually covers

This service is about ongoing psychiatric care, not a quick medication refill button. During a telehealth follow-up, we review how you’ve been doing since the last visit, what changed in your mood, sleep, concentration, stress, or side effects, and whether the current plan still fits your goals. If medication is being considered, it’s discussed with the same care we use in person: the reason for the choice, what it is meant to address, and what monitoring makes sense. We do not guess. We talk through the information we have, then make the next step together.

What we look at during follow-up

We keep the conversation practical. That usually includes symptom changes, how you’ve been sleeping, whether concentration has shifted, appetite changes, stress load, and how you’re tolerating any current treatment. If supportive therapy techniques are useful during the visit, we can weave them in. That might mean talking through coping skills, routines, or how to notice patterns between medication timing, mood, and day-to-day function. The point is steady monitoring, not rushing through the appointment.

What the first few telehealth visits look like

Most people want to know how this actually works before they book. Fair question. The process is straightforward, and it’s built to give us enough information to make thoughtful decisions without turning the visit into a long, stressful interview. Here’s the usual flow for online medication management in Fairfield CT.

  1. Start with your background. We review your health history, current concerns, and treatment goals so we can understand the full picture, not just one symptom.
  2. Talk through options. If medication, therapy, or a combination makes sense, we explain the general plan, the benefits being considered, and possible side effects so you can make an informed choice.
  3. Set a monitoring plan. Follow-up visits are used to track response over time and discuss changes in mood, sleep, concentration, stress, or daily function.
  4. Adjust carefully if needed. If the treatment plan needs attention, changes are made with clinical judgment and close follow-up, not by rushing through assumptions.

A few practical things to keep in mind

Before your visit, make sure you have a stable internet connection, a quiet space, and a list of any current medications or recent changes.
